Indianola- Jerri C. Harris was lifted on the wings of Angels to Heaven at 7:30 AM on Wednesday, May 11, 2011. Jerri was born on May 25, 1944 to Ruth Iona (Butts) Harris and Orie Edward Harris in Danville, IL. He attended Westville Schools and lived in Home Gardens. Later he entered the US Army. Jerri served 4 years active duty and 6 years in the reserves as a drill instructor. Jerri married Sharon Kay Huttsell on June 8, 1968. They had two daughters from this marriage, Kari Sue Harris-Coe and Christy Harris. Sharon preceded Jerri in death from a long battle with cancer. They were married for 17 years. Jerri later married Shirley (Curtis) Harris. With this marriage Jerri became father to two sons, Robert Wolcott and Gregory (Ashley) Harrier, two daughters, Carolyn (Ray) Jackson and Kristina (Scott) Jones. Jerri loved all of his children very much. He has ten grandchildren and two great-grandchildren. Grandchildren are Ashlee (Wolcott) Gonzalez, Corey Wolcott, Zachary and Carissa Schumacher, Hannah and Hope Johnson, Abby and Ethan Jones, and Reese and Caden Harrier. Great-Grandchildren are Lillianna and Raulan Gonzalez. Jerri was an auto body specialist for over 30 years. Jerri loved to cut up, tease, and joke. He especially liked to dance, drink, beer, fish, fix anything, cut down trees, and most of all spend time with family and friends. Jerri was very kind, caring, and loving husband, father, brother, uncle, grandfather, and friend. He liked to help others very much and will be missed deeply by all who knew and loved him. Jerri is survived by his wife Shirley of almost twenty-sex years, brother Mark (Lillian) Harris, two sisters, Sharon (Mike) Hoskins, Andrea Harris and Mike Bernardi. He was preceded in death by his parents and one sister Carolyn (Rick) Alley. Jerri considered Mike Curtis, Larry (Jadaun) Curtis, Kenneth (Susan) Curtis as his brothers also. Jerri also considered Barbara (Mark) Thiede as a sister. Jerri leaves behind many special nieces and nephews, cousins, aunt and uncles, and friends he loved very much.
